Position Description:
Community Care Provider These positions are responsible for providing active treatment (primarily for Activities of Daily Living), implementing individual treatment/behavior programs, general household work, daily activities, as well as assisting individuals with intellectual disabilities with normal day to day activities. In addition, these individuals may have mental health or behavioral disorders. These positions assist individuals with acquiring skills for personal independence. Some clients may have physical disabilities which require specialized equipment and/or manual lift techniques to assist with repositioning and lifting of individuals. In addition to working as a Caregiver, the Caregiver serves as a counselor, guide, coach, and mentor in a long-term, ongoing relationship with the individuals we serve. Caregivers will provide client support through activities in efforts to improve the client's quality of life.
